Abstract

1327043 Clocks HORSTMANN CLIFFORD MAGNETICS Ltd 7 April 1971 [12 Jan 1970] 1340/70 Heading G3T In a driving arrangement for a clock having an electrically maintained member which is magnetically coupled to a rotor via a wavy track and oscillates parallel to the rotor axis, the magnetic reluctance of the median portion of the magnetic track is increased as compared with the remainder of the track, in order to improve the self-starting and isochronous performance. Figs.2, 3 show a rotor formed of two toothed discs 27, 28 which are of magnetic material and are mounted on a spindle 30 with one disc offset with respect to the other. The oscillating magnetic member is in the form of a ring 31 and has teeth 32 cooperating with the magnetic track formed by the disc teeth. Further embodiments are described in which the toothed rotor discs are spaced apart by a disc magnet (49), Fig.4 (not shown) and cooperate with an oscillating member (50) of high permeability, or in which the rotor consists of two star-shaped magnets (54, 55) Fig. 5 (not shown) sandwiched between retaining members (58, 59). The rotor may also be formed by a crinkled disc (80) Fig. 7 (not shown) whose periphery is provided with a central groove (84) and which co-operates with an oscillating magnet (82). The wavy magnetic track may also be formed on the oscillating member and Fig. 6, (not shown), shows an annular oscillating element (65) which includes a ring magnet (69) and has the wavy track formed on its inner surface which surrounds the rotor (76). Other embodiments are described using a rotor comprising two crinkled discs (150, 151) Fig. 9 (not shown) or spoked discs (157, 158) Fig.10 (not shown) spaced apart on a common spindle (152) and co-operating with an annular magnetic oscillating member (153).
